Chabad Castel Stew House
An inseparable part of our responsibility as a community, and of each and every one as an individual, is to take care of those who don’t. We opened the stew house to help the needy, the elderly, the sick and the infertile who do not have hot meals. Some of them are in a difficult economic situation, along with many who can buy food for themselves, but simply… There is no one to cook for them! For all these, the heart and the house is open. Here they enjoy a hot meal every Shabbat, good company and above all – out of a homely and pleasant feeling that preserves their dignity.
Hot Food Door To Door
Every Saturday we send close to 200 cooked dishes to the homes of lonely, elderly, sick and disabled people who cannot come and eat with us. The hot meal allows them to enjoy a sense of Shabbat and brings some light into their homes and lives.
In preparation for the High Holidays and Passover, we are holding a special operation in which hundreds of hot meals are distributed to the needy – individuals and families, who enjoy a holiday atmosphere with dignity.
In addition, we hold community dinners in which families from the community also participate. That way, none of the people sitting at the table feel needy – and we’re all happy together!
